So I have a 1994 Elite S with 700 miles that I have converted to an SR. This is what I have done so far:

Removed washer on variator (also replaced rollers and belt with brand new OEM ones)
Ground out and de-restricted exhaust
Upjetted carb to SR 78 jet
New SR oil pump
New SR spilt oil pump cable

I am looking to speed it up to about 50mph without kitting it. Anyone have an exact recipe for getting me to 50? I have read through tons on posts and came up with lots of different answers but I thought I would ask again. It seems like maybe swapping out the variator and gears should get me to 50mph. Does anyone have any input on that setup or maybe a different one? Any specific parts that you guys recommend? Anything else I might want to consider...do I need to upjet again?
